Can You Buy Adderall Over the Counter in the USA?

The simple answer is no, you are not able to buy Adderall over the counter in the United States. Adderall is a prescription that requires a proper prescription from a licensed medical professional. Possessing or using Adderall without a prescription is illegal.

There are heavy penalties for obtaining Adderall illegally, including penalties and even jail time.

If you think you may benefit from medication for ADHD or another medical concern, it's crucial to see a doctor. They can evaluate your symptoms and suggest the most suitable treatment options.

Safely Managing ADHD Without Prescription Adderall

Living with ADHD can be tough, but it doesn't mean you have to rely on prescription medications like Adderall. There are plenty of safe and effective ways to cope with your symptoms without drugs. One vital step is to build a routine that works for you. This could include creating regular sleep times, eating healthy meals, and incorporating physical activity into your day.

It's also essential to identify your triggers and develop strategies for coping with them. For example, if you find that certain environments or situations make it difficult to focus, try to reduce your exposure to those things. You can also experiment with techniques like mindfulness practice or mindfulness activities to help calm your mind and improve your focus.

Finally, don't be afraid to seek assistance. Talking to a therapist or counselor can provide you with valuable insights about ADHD and strategies for managing it effectively. There are also many online tools available, including support groups and forums where you can connect with other people who understand what you're going through.
